The Application Process
The journey to acquiring a driver's license in Belgium includes numerous crucial steps:
- Enroll in a Driving School: It is suggested to enroll in a driving school signed up in Belgium, particularly for newbie applicants. This ensures that you get the needed training and meet the needed requirements.
- Pass the Theory Test: After finishing your coursework, applicants need to pass a theoretical test that checks traffic rules, safety guidelines, and roadway signs.
- Practice Driving: Once the theory test is passed, candidates should get practical driving experience, generally with a qualified instructor.
- Practical Driving Test: After enough practice, prospects take the useful driving test, which assesses their driving abilities under real traffic conditions.
- Send Application: Upon passing both tests, applicants can submit their application for the motorist's license, including all required files and payment of fees.
- Get Temporary License: After approval, a short-lived license can be released until the main license arrives.

Common Challenges and Solutions
While the process for obtaining a motorist's license in Belgium is simple, applicants may deal with a number of difficulties.
List of Common Challenges:
Language Barrier: The driving theory tests are often carried out in Dutch, French, or German, causing problems for non-native speakers.
- Solution: Many driving schools provide lessons and products in English or other languages.
High Costs: Some might discover the costs of driving school and tests expensive.
- Option: Look for inexpensive driving schools and ask about payment plans.
Exam Anxiety: Failing the theory or useful exam can discourage applicants.
- Service: Ensure adequate practice and consider mock tests to develop confidence.
